Bes, я удаляю героя с карты. На экране КП. Но при клике на активном герое для его удаления вызывается окно героя! И только после его закрытия, герой удаляется повторным кликом на нём, если не двигаться им. Иначе заново всю процедуру.
Вырезал часть кода, отвечающую за иной тип клика ( Shift+LMB ) (Click to View)